Table 1. Case reports of jejunal varices with their cause, condition, and treatment in patients without pancreas-kidney transplantation.
Source | Cause of duodenal varices | Portal hypertension | Hepatic |cirrhosis | Treatment |
---|---|---|---|---|
Robert et al (2010) []8 | Hepatic cirrhosis, segmental resection of intestine in hernia | Yes | Yes | Coil embolization |
Koo et al (2011) []9 | Hepatic cirrhosis, small-bowel resection due to trauma | Yes | Yes | Coil embolization |
Hiraoka et al (2001) []10 | Case 1&2: portal vein stenosis pancreaticoduodenectomy with intraoperative radiation therapy Respectively choledocojejunostomy | Yes | No | Case 1&2: balloon dilatation; Case 2: Stent placement |
Lein et al (1992) []11 | Pancreatitis and Roux-en-Y cholecystojejunostomy | Yes | No | Resection of involved jejunal segment |
Deshpande et al (2008) []13 | No more detailed abdominal surgery | No | No | Resection of involved jejunal segment |
Gonçalves et al (2015) []14 | Pylorus-preserving pancreatoduodenectomy in pancreatic adenocarcinoma | Injection of a mixture of cyano-acrylate and Lipiodol | ||
Kastanakis et al (2013) []15 | Cholecystectomy | No | No | Resection of involved jejunal segment |
